AccorHotels confirms Novotel London Canary Wharf to open by end of 2016

By James Russell: AccorHotels confirms Novotel London Canary Wharf to open by end of 2016

June 14, 2016

AccorHotels today announces that its new flagship Novotel in London’s Canary Wharf will open to guests this year. The Novotel Canary Wharf is situated at 40 Marsh Street and at 127 metres high is set to be one of the tallest buildings in the area. The hotel will comprise of 313 rooms including 26 suites.
